Quality Assurance Process & Checklist

Quality assurance (QA) is an important part of ensuring that code releases are tested correctly before being handed over, or new app releases being put up on Google Play.

Automated tests can go a long way, but some areas still need manual testing, especially before we have much wider code coverage.

Before an app release is handed over, the QA checklist template will be completed, and all tests passing before release.

Workflow:

  1. Create a copy of the QA checklist, with filename in the format: <app>-<version>-<date> and place this in the same folder on Google Drive as the apk file.

  2. Assign the testing tasks to individuals - ideally there would be a different set of people who are doing the tests to those who worked on the coding.

  3. Once all the tests have been completed, and are passing, the code can be released/handed over.
